THE TUSCAN LIGHT
The quality of the Tuscan Light is truly special. The southwestern part of Tuscany is called the Maremma. Its rolling hills and valley’s are populated with olives orchards, vineyards and many spectacular Castel towns.

Sorano: Tuscany
SORANO is just one of the medieval hill towns that we will be exploring as part of our daily photo excursions. From this ancient Etruscan town you can see many Etruscan tombs carved out from the stone cliff walls. Discovering Sorano will be a experience not to be forgotten.
